Comprehending Cheap Robot Hoovers
What is a Robot Hoover?
A robot hoover, essentially a robot vacuum, is a device created to autonomously tidy floorings and carpets. These gadgets use a mix of sensing units, brushes, and suction capabilities to navigate through a living space, getting dust, dirt, and debris with minimal human intervention.
Key Features of Cheap Robot Hoovers
While the performance of less expensive designs usually does not compare to their premium equivalents, many budget robot hoovers still provide a range of functional functions:
Feature
Description
Suction Power
Varies between designs but normally enough for light cleaning jobs.
Navigation System
Fundamental designs use gyroscopic sensing units, while some might have more advanced sensors for mapping.
Battery Life
Generally lasts between 60-90 minutes, depending on the system.
Dust Bin Capacity
Smaller sized bins might need frequent clearing but are adequate for little homes.
Remote Control/Wi-Fi Connectivity
Fundamental models may include a remote; sophisticated options allow app control.
Set up Cleaning
Some designs permit users to program cleaning times, improving convenience.
Rate Range
Generally between ₤ 100-₤ 300, depending on features and brand name.
Advantages of Cheap Robot Hoovers
- Time-Saving: With a robot hoover, users can automate the regular job of vacuuming, freeing up time for other family chores or personal activities.
- Ease of Use: Many designs are created with user-friendly features that make them easy to run, even for those not familiar with innovation.
- Space Saving: Their compact design permits them to navigate tight areas and under furnishings where conventional vacuums might struggle.
- Upkeep: Robot hoovers typically come with self-cleaning brushes and other functions that reduce the need for substantial maintenance.
- Health Benefits: Regular automated cleaning can help in reducing irritants and dust accumulation in the home, contributing to much better air quality.
Factors to consider When Buying a Cheap Robot Hoover
Despite their benefits, there are numerous considerations to bear in mind when selecting a cost effective robot hoover:
- Suction Power: Determine if the vacuum has sufficient suction to satisfy your cleaning needs, especially if you have animals.
- Dust Bin Capacity: Smaller dust bins might need to be cleared more regularly, which can be bothersome.
- Navigation Ability: Budget models may do not have sophisticated navigation systems, possibly triggering them to get stuck or miss locations.
- Battery Life: Consider what area you'll need to tidy; much shorter battery life may not cover larger spaces in one session.
- Resilience: Cheaper models might use lower-quality materials, resulting in lowered longevity and performance.

2. Can a robot hoover get pet hair?
Numerous less expensive models can picking up pet hair, specifically those developed with specialized brushes. Nevertheless, the performance can vary, so it's vital to examine user reviews or specs.
3. How often should I clear the dust bin of a robot hoover?
This mostly depends upon the amount of cleaning and the size of your home. For smaller sized homes, clearing the dust bin after each cleaning session is typically sufficient, while bigger families may need to do so more regularly.
4. Are cheap robot hoovers worth it?
For those wanting to minimize manual vacuuming without a significant investment, cheap robot hoovers can be an important addition to household cleaning routines. They shine in benefit but may fall brief in power and durability compared to higher-end items.
5. Can I use a robot hoover on both carpets and tough floors?
Most robot hoovers are developed to deal with a range of surface areas, consisting of carpets and tough floorings. Nevertheless, inspecting the specifications for each model is suggested to ensure compatibility and performance.
